Vikings sign Brian O’Neill to four-year contract extension
The Vikings lock in right tackle Brian O’Neill on a four‑year deal, securing their offensive line ahead of training camp.

The story so far
By securing O’Neill, Minnesota gains continuity on the edge while the player obtains long‑term financial security. The extension comes as the team prepares for its upcoming training camp, positioning both club and player to benefit from a stable roster heading into the season. Later coverage added context.
The Star Tribune noted that the deal was finalized before the start of camp, underscoring the timing’s importance for roster planning. Daily Norseman reported that the agreement reached a four‑year term, mirroring language used by the team. None of the outlets present conflicting details; each source reports the same four‑year extension for O’Neill.
The consensus leaves the current status clear: Brian O’Neill will remain with Minnesota under the new deal, and the team moves forward with its reinforced line.
